I have all of the original *roff manuals formatted w/ groff.  I did a
few cleanups but they are basically the stuff from Bell Labs.  I got
them from the TUHS site and so far as I know they are cool to be handed
out.  I can check with dmr or bwk.  If I get an OK, is there any reason
to not include these with groff?

> The groff source distribution comes with several examples:
> 
> - The pic manual uses the -ms macro package, which is the most popular of the 
> standard packages.
> 
> - The manual for the -me macro package, written using the -me macros.
> 
> - The manual for the -mom macro package, written using the -mom macros.
> 
> A few of us transcribed the book "Unix Text Processing" a while back, the 
> source and PDF can be found at http://home.windstream.net/kollar/utp/ (my 
> website).
